Ford Escape: Engine Cooling / Removal and Installation - Heater Hoses

Special Tool(s) / General Equipment

Hose Clamp Remover/Installer

Removal

NOTE: Removal steps in this procedure may contain installation details.

  1. Drain the cooling system.
    Refer to: Engine Cooling System Draining, Vacuum Filling and Bleeding (303-03C Engine Cooling, General Procedures).
  1. Remove the cowl panel grille.
    Refer to: Cowl Panel Grille (501-02 Front End Body Panels, Removal and Installation).
  1. Release the clamp and disconnect the coolant hose.
    Use the General Equipment: Hose Clamp Remover/Installer
  1. Release the clamp and disconnect the coolant hose.
    Use the General Equipment: Hose Clamp Remover/Installer
  1. Release the clamps and remove the heater hoses.
    Use the General Equipment: Hose Clamp Remover/Installer

Installation

  1. To install, reverse the removal procedure.
  1. Fill and bleed the cooling system.
    Refer to: Engine Cooling System Draining, Vacuum Filling and Bleeding (303-03C Engine Cooling, General Procedures).
